Just another point to add is that anyone unsure of how to fit the pipes then please don't be put off the group buy. I'm sure one of our very helpfull members will make a video on how to do it. Alternativley the haynes manual will cover replacing the coolant and pipes and there is no diference to fitting oem parts when fitting these silicone hoses (Apart from the fact they'll look Awesome and last longer  Wink ) or at the end of the day if you'r not confident enough to do it yourself I'm sure a garage would do it for a small fee. Not a huge job so wouldn't cost you much. Coolant is often forgotten about by home servicers and even some garages can be a bit laxs about it so well worth getting it done!
